Understanding the Behavior of Venomous Snakes Like the Tiger Snake
The Tiger Snake, medically known as Notechis scutatus, is infamous for its aggressive nature when endangered. These snakes show a variety of habits that can be fairly different from their non-venomous equivalents.
Characteristics of Tiger Snakes
The Tiger Snake is quickly recognizable due to its unique bands or red stripes that resemble a tiger's markings. They can differ in shade from yellowish-brown to dark olive or black. This coloration serves not just as camouflage yet additionally as a caution signal to possible predators.
Adaptability to Environment
One remarkable facet of their habits is their versatility to different settings. Located primarily in seaside areas, marshes, and marshes throughout Australia and Tasmania, they can grow in diverse habitats consisting of metropolitan areas.
Hunting Techniques
Tiger Serpents are ambush killers primarily eating fish, frogs, and small animals. They possess eager vision and a severe sense of odor which aids them in locating prey effectively.

Venom Composition
Their venom has neurotoxins that affect the nerve system, bring about paralysis or death in smaller animals. For human beings, immediate clinical attention is crucial after a tiger serpent bite due to its potentially deadly effects.

Common Misunderstandings About Tiger Snakes
Many people believe false impressions regarding the behaviors of tiger serpents cause unnecessary fear. Below are some explanations:
Myth 1: All Tigers Are Aggressive
Not all tiger snakes will display aggressiveness if left undisturbed; several prefer leaving rather than confrontation.
Myth 2: They Chase Humans
Tiger snakes do not proactively chase humans; they might strike when they really feel endangered however will usually pull away if given space.
